Egenskapen direction
Egenskapen direction ställer in riktningen
för text som ritas med metoden fillText
eller metoden strokeText.
Tar ett av de möjliga värdena: ltr
(vänster till höger), rtl (höger till vänster), inherit
(ärvs). Som standard är värdet
inherit (för arabiska och hebreiska blir det
rtl, eftersom de skriver från höger till vänster, medan för
alla andra - ltr).
Syntax
kontext.direction = ltr eller rtl eller inherit;
Exempel
Låt oss skriva text och ställa in den med
olika riktningar med hjälp av
egenskapen direction:
<canvas id="canvas" width="200" height="200" style="background: #f4f4f4;"></canvas>
const canvas = document.getElementById("canvas");
const ctx = canvas.getContext("2d");
ctx.font = "16px arial";
ctx.fillText("text1", 150, 50);
ctx.direction = "rtl";
ctx.fillText("text1", 50, 120);
:
Se även
-
egenskapen
textBaseline,
som justerar text vertikalt -
egenskapen
textAlign,
som justerar text horisontellt